| 2013-05-22 11:07:58 utc | jmettraux | furqan: hello and welcome to #ruote |
| 2013-05-22 11:09:17 utc | furqan | jmettraux |
| 2013-05-22 11:09:23 utc | furqan | thanks |
| 2013-05-22 11:09:24 utc | jmettraux | furqan: |
| 2013-05-22 11:11:31 utc | furqan | i have a question, i have a scenario in which i have to send out email notifications every last tuesday and last friday of every month. can i accomplish this using rufus ? |
| 2013-05-22 11:11:46 utc | jmettraux | yes¥ |
| 2013-05-22 11:12:18 utc | furqan | but how do i get last tuesday and friday ? |
| 2013-05-22 11:13:10 utc | furqan | i know tue#1 is first tuesday, right ? |
| 2013-05-22 11:13:33 utc | furqan | but how would i know which one is the last tuesday 4 or 5 ? |
| 2013-05-22 11:14:06 utc | jmettraux | check if today + 7 days falls in the same month |
| 2013-05-22 11:15:33 utc | furqan | if i do Date.today.end_of_month.beginning_of_week.next, will rufus accept this ? |
| 2013-05-22 11:16:38 utc | jmettraux | #at should accept it if it returns a date |
| 2013-05-22 11:17:02 utc | jmettraux | you can try ;-) |
| 2013-05-22 11:21:02 utc | jmettraux | furqan: https://github.com/jmettraux/rufus-scheduler/issues/54 added to the TODO list somehow, thanks! |
| 2013-05-22 11:22:14 utc | jmettraux | for now, I'd go with a cron job that triggers every tue/fri and then immediately exit if it's not the last tue/fri |
| 2013-05-22 11:23:03 utc | furqan | ah, i thought sun#1 was supported :/ |
| 2013-05-22 11:24:23 utc | furqan | https://github.com/jmettraux/rufus-scheduler, 2.0.9 was supposed to support this right ? |
| 2013-05-22 11:24:55 utc | furqan | i see, i got it now. |
| 2013-05-22 11:25:02 utc | furqan | u're right |
| 2013-05-22 11:34:16 utc | furqan | scheduler.at Date.today.end_of_month.beginning_of_week.next does not work. ArgumentError: no block or :schedulable passed, nothing to schedule |
| 2013-05-22 11:37:35 utc | furqan | finally i got it, scheduler.at Date.today.end_of_month.beginning_of_week.next.to_time |
| 2013-05-22 11:37:51 utc | furqan | and don't forget to pass a block |
| 2013-05-22 11:37:53 utc | furqan | :D |
| 2013-05-22 11:43:05 utc | furqan | jmettraux, one quick question. #at is converted to cron job right ? |
| 2013-05-22 11:58:56 utc | jmettraux | no, cron jobs and at jobs are implemented differently |
| 2013-05-22 12:09:47 utc | jmettraux | got to leave, if someone can pass him the message if he comes back... |